Somewhere I read that today is International Reggae Day.

Somewhere else I read an article about the success of Jamaican track and fielders bringing smiles to the country.

The contrast between the two worlds — of violence and of athletic excellence — finds a reflection in music with the hardcore ‘dancehall’ often glorifying the gang lifestyle while the lighter melodies of reggae pay tribute to athletic prowess.

There is already a tune called 9.72 in tribute to ‘Lightning Bolt’.
